Almost 16 Months...Updated w/ Pics!
We just had our 15 month check-up 3 weeks late and the stats were:
Matthew: 33 inches tall (90 percentile)
21.2 pounds (10th percentile)
Andrew: 31.5 inches tall (60th percentile)
22.1 pounds (25th percentile)
I worry just a touch about Matthew's weight. He doesn't look overly thin or malnourished. The pediatrician isn't worried at all. But...I do try to feed him extra and put butter on his waffles and English muffins. He's so active...constantly running around and he is sooo picky at meals. He hates vegetables and almost all meat items. He's used to love fruit but I've noticed he leaving more and more fruit on his plate at meals. He seems to be a carb addict. He wants crackers, cookies, granola bars, etc... although at times he cracks us up b/c he'll love something spicy that we're eating. I gave him spicy onion meatloaf that I had made for J and both boys loved it. Eww! I personally don't like meatloaf. I ended up feeding that meatloaf to the boys for three days b/c I was so excited that Matthew was eating meat. I also gave them chili lime chicken patties one night and Matthew loved that too. Only that one time though. I'll have to make another meatloaf and see if they still like it.
Andrew is less of a concern. He always been and continues to be a great eater. He likes pretty much everything. The only thing is he's not a huge fan of water. He'll drink it but only a few sips whereas Matthew guzzles water all day long.
They do love milk! Love it! Can't get enough. I give them a sippy cup w/ 8oz in the morning when they first wake and they get another 6-8oz in the afternoon w/ their snack. They could easily drink more but my doctor said to keep it below 16oz per day.
Milestones and more:
- Matthew has had 16 teeth since 13 months and Andrew has had 16 teeth since 14 months. So no more teething until they get their very back molars which shouldn't be for another year. Both boys got their first tooth at 8 1/2 months so that's a lot of teeth in a short period of time.
- Matthew can run...truly run no problem. He goes up and down stairs, he goes down the slide by himself, and plays on the small children's play equipment at the park no problem. He's like Forrest Gump b/c he never stops. He goes goes goes....
- Andrew is still crawling most of the time. He takes a half dozen independent steps a few times a day. I think he gets impatient w/ his wobbly walking when he wants to keep up w/ his brother so he speed crawls and he can crawl super fast.
- Andrew can climb almost as well as his brother although he's not as sure footed. He sure tries though. Both can get up and onto the couches...including on top of the back of the couch *sigh* They also like to stand on the recliner and ride it like a surf board *sigh* and they pile their toys in front of the entertainment center so they can climb them to reach non-baby items *sigh* Luckily they can get down fairly easily most of time so I don't worry as much as I used to.
- Matthew has decided it's fun to bash toys into Andrews head and he also likes to push him into the wall. So Matthew is now in time-out several times a day. I put him in a pack in play that's in our master bedroom. I say "No... Not Nice... Time Out" while shaking my head and then put him in the pack and play. I leave him for about one minute and then bring him back out. I'm hoping I can warn him off w/ the shaking of my head in the future.
- Both boys get very physical but Matthew is "rougher" about it. Sometimes I wish Andrew knew he was bigger so he could push Matthew off him.
- Matthew gives me hugs and kisses all day long. I can open my arms wide and Matthew will run into them to hug me. I love this of course and forgive him immediately for everything naughty he's done all day long. =)
- Andrew loves to be thrown into the air or ride horsey on your knee. He laughs a full belly laugh. He also cannot have you chase him around the house enough. Never tires of it. Around and around we go....
- The boys love mega bloks. We play w/ them all day long. J and I enjoy them too. We build stuff as fast as we can while they knock it down.
- Andrew's favorite toy is a big blown up balloon. He bats it all around the house.
- The boys hate having their teeth brushed. We sing the alphabet song while brushing their teeth so I wonder if they'll hate that song since they'll associate it w/ something unpleasant to them.
- Andrew is a wonderful sleeper! He rarely wakes up at night. When he does it sucks though since he's very difficult to get back down. Matthew... not a great sleeper.
- Both boys will try to help you dress/undress them. They will raise a foot or arm which is something they've only been doing the last month or two.
- They aren't saying a whole lot. Both say MaMa, DaDa, Ut Oh, will point and say "that", and that's all I clearly understand. Sometimes I think they'll say something but then I won't hear it again so I'm not sure. Andrew can sign the word water very well... I think he just likes that he's communicating w/ me b/c he'll sign the word and get excited when I give him his sippy cup but not really want it.
- Both boys wave good-bye.
- Both are in size 4 diapers and wear size 18 month clothing.
